PROJECT MANAGER IN KANSAS CITY

OPEN OPPORTUNITY

SUMMARY

We are seeking an experienced Project Manager with hands-on construction experience to support multiple phases of large, mixed-use residential tower projects in Kansas City. The ideal candidate will have a background in general contracting, construction management, owner's project management, and/or a past history in superintendent roles and must be comfortable managing both field coordination and project reporting.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Construction Oversight & Coordination

    • Monitor and manage general contractor performance, schedule quality, and logistics

    • Conduct regular jobsite walks, identify field issues, and proactively manage resolutions

    • Review and validate construction progress for monthly pay applications

  • Schedule & Budget Management

    • Track construction schedules, flag risks and delays, and recommend mitigation strategies

    • Assist with monthly reporting and updates to internal and client teams

    • Review change orders, RFIs, and submittals for scope, cost, and constructability impacts

  • Stakeholder Communication & Documentation

    • Lead weekly OAC (Owner-Architect-Contractor) meetings and track action items

    • Maintain updated project documentation including meeting minutes, field reports, and punch lists

    • Collaborate closely with architects, engineers, contractors, and city officials

  • Quality Assurance & Closeout

    • Oversee mockup reviews and quality control milestones throughout construction

    • Help manage punch list walkthroughs and project closeout

    • Ensure that turnover documents, O&M manuals, and as-builts are delivered and complete

​

REQUIRED TECHNICAL SKILLS & QUALIFICATIONS

  • 10+ years of experience in construction management, general contracting, or as a superintendent

  • Strong understanding of construction documents, contracts, and field operations

  • Familiarity with mixed-use, multifamily, hotel and/or high-rise construction

  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office, Excel, and Bluebeam

  • Ability to read and interpret architectural, structural, MEP, and civil drawings

  • Strong verbal and written communication skills
